Medical Cost Projection - Certified

Criteria

MCP-C Criteria

01

Education

  • Candidate must have a minimum of a bachelor’s degree in the medical, healthcare, or rehabilitation field.
02

Licensure / Certification

  • Candidate must have a current, active, and unrestricted licensure or certification in the candidate’s primary practice within the medical, healthcare, or rehabilitation field.
  • Examples (but not limited to) – 
    • Licensure
      • Registered Nurse (RN, NP)
      • Physician (MD, DC, DO, PhD)
      • Occupational Therapist (OT)
      • Physical Therapist (PT)
      • Speech Therapist (ST)
      • Counselor (LPC, LMHC)
      • Social Worker (LCSW, LISW, LICSW)
    • Certification
      • Rehabilitation Counselor (CRC)
      • Case Manager (CCM)
      • Disability Management Specialist (CDMS)
03

Employment

  • Candidate must have a minimum of two years of full-time paid employment within the primary practice of medical, healthcare, or rehabilitation field.
04

Medical cost projection Training

  • Upload FIG Certificate of Completion & FIG’s  MCP Peer Review Letter to MCP Case Study/Redacted Report.

*Final approval of the application for certification will be at the discretion and decision of the FIG Advisory Board.  Decisions regarding application for certification will be final and without appeal by the FIG Advisory Board.*
